EDIH, the Heritage Smart Lab Project kicks off

The activities of the **European Digital Innovation Hub - Heritage SmartLab** commenced in November 2022. This is a European centre fully dedicated to the digital transformation of the cultural heritage sector and the Cultural and Creative Industries, a key area in the Smart Specialisation Strategies of Campania, Basilicata, and Puglia, and will be headquartered in Matera, European Capital of Culture, with two hubs in Naples and Bari.
Heritage SmartLab is one of the 136 European Digital Innovation Hubs (EDIH) selected and funded by the European Commission in the 27 EU countries, aiming to support the digital transition of SMEs and public administrations, particularly focusing on technology domains such as Artificial Intelligence, High-Performance Computing, and Cybersecurity.
The EDIH, located in Napoli Est in Campania, serves the digital transformation of startups, SMEs, and Italian and European public administrations, offering free demonstration and prototyping services, support for access to finance, Academy programs, and advanced training, initiatives for Open Innovation and Acceleration, as well as technology brokerage and matchmaking initiatives between demand and offer of innovation at an international level.
The project is the result of significant entities from our region, including the lead organisation Basilicata Creativa, Sviluppo Basilicata, the DIH Basilicata, the Lucanian Clusters on Aerospace, Energy, Automotive, and for Campania and Puglia the MedITech competence centre, Iniziativa srl and naturally SPICI srl - which also coordinated the drafting of the project proposal.
Users will have 4 ACCESS points to the EDIH through:
The enhancement of the offer of technologies and services by companies/SMEs and startups, which will participate in the acceleration program Digital Innovation and Acceleration Program;
Working on the demand for new technologies and digital solutions, to assist companies in need, through participation in the Open Innovation Program;
Training activities for talents participating in the educational activities of the HSL Talents’ Academy;
Activities for the national and international creative community, citizens, and the entire innovation ecosystem, through major Annual Events.
The various users/customers interacting with the EDIH will become part of a community of creatives and can undertake a Digital Innovation Journey through various customised services available to them, including Test Before Invest or support for searching for calls and funding.
